2. Online Guide
The Smart Communities Guide is an online resource
designed to help communities advance their progress in
becoming a Smart/Intelligent Community.
Features:
• Practical guide to creating Smart Communities -- the
single most important economic and social activity being
undertaken in the world today
• Measurement-based Indicators so all communities can
monitor their own success
• Links to solutions and people, from best-in-class
organizations
